10. Error messages and trouble shooting
DANGER
Risk of death by electrocution
Potentially fatal voltage is applied to the inverter
during operation. This potentially fatal voltage is
still present for some time after all power sources
have been disconnected.
► Never open the inverter.
► Always disconnect the inverter from power
before installation, open the AC/DC Discon-
nection switch and make sure neither can be
accidentally reconnected.
► Wait 30 seconds until the capacitors have
discharged.
DANGER
Risk of death or serious injury from electro-
cution
Potentially fatal voltage may be applied to the
DC connections of the inverter. When light is fall-
ing on solar modules, they immediately start pro-
ducing energy. They do so, even when the sun is
not shining directly onto the solar modules.
► Never disconnect the solar modules when the
inverter is powered.
► First switch off the grid connection so that the
inverter cannot feed energy into the grid.
► Turn the AC/DC Disconnection switch to posi-
tion OFF.
► Make sure the DC connections cannot be
accidentally touched.
The inverter contains no internal components
that must be maintained or repaired by the op-
erator or installer. All repairs must be performed
by Delta Energy Systems. Opening the cover will
void the warranty.
